As Quality Engineer for our Sensors facility, you will ensure our manufacturing processes comply with aerospace regulations such as AS9100 and Civil Aviation Authority for production, maintenance organisation. You will conduct product and process audits and engineering inspection reviews to verify that finished products meet technical drawings, specifications and regulations.
In your role, you will be liaising with customers and will perform investigations on customer returns, conducting root cause analysis and proposing corrective and preventive actions to address defects and process inefficiencies.
Responsibilities:
* Develop, apply and revise quality standards for receiving, in-process and final inspection in accordance with company and contractual requirements.
* Review and evaluate in-process rejections, obtain disposition and implement corrective action as needed.
* Interface with customers, vendors and various company departments to resolve quality problems and provide information.
* Participate in audits.
* Provide technical support to inspection personnel as needed.
* Prepare and provide product assurance documentation as required by customer programs.
* Perform analysis of reports and production data to identify trends and recommend updates or changes to quality standards and procedures when necessary.
* Assure compliance to in-house and/or external specifications, standards and provide product assurance documentation as required by customer programs.
